Since 1946, Tanury Industries has represented the cutting-edge of the plating industry, pioneering new technologies, and elevating quality control and customer service to new levels of excellence. Tanury offers the largest range of high-specification decorative plating services available. Our corrosion and scratch-resistant coatings come in a wide range of colors and styles. Unique benefits include superior wear resistance, high hardness, outstanding adhesion, and lifetime finish. At Tanury, our commitment to quality and consistency is at the core of what we do, driving both our business and our processes. In fact, we were the first decorative electroplater in the United States to achieve ISO-9001 registration, a worldwide standard of quality. Through our quality-control process, we utilize continual testing and advanced diagnostic methods to ensure not only that each product meets our specifications and standards, but also that the chemistry is 100% consistent throughout. Our mission is to use cutting-edge technologies and to establish the best practices needed to develop cost effective and innovative finishing solutions for our clients. In 1994, Tanury introduced Physical Vapor Deposition to the decorative coating market place. Using a unique dry-vacuum process, parts are coated with materials such as ultra-hard zirconium or titanium nitrides. We are constantly auditing and improving out services. Teaming with our clients, we leverage our advanced capabilities and the expertise of our R&D staff to discover and develop new finishes. By undertaking R&D projects alongside our customers, we can shorten developmental lead-time for new processes and finishes, saving both time and money.

    ACS Industries Inc. has been selected by the U.S. Department of Energy’s Hydrogen and Fuel Cells Technologies Office for award negotiation of a $9.9 million grant to industrialize novel manufacturing methods in the production of key PEM electrolyzer components. This work is critical to driving down cost and increasing electrolyzer performance in line with the Department of Energy’s 2031 “Hydrogen Shot” goals. To complete this initiative, ACS will be collaborating closely with project partners Plug Power, Tanury Industries, and the University of California, Irvine. This project will result in significant benefits to the community including: a paid internship for disadvantaged undergraduate students; the development of a certification program for operation and maintenance of highly technical manufacturing equipment to help train the workforce of tomorrow; and the establishment of a DAC-based factory with an initial 60 clean energy jobs. ACS thanks the U.S. Department of Energy, funded by the Bipartisan Infrastructure Law, for its support in creating a robust and resilient hydrogen supply chain in the U.S. while also creating impactful clean energy jobs. The ACS-led project will make significant progress in the effort to lower the cost of green hydrogen to achieve global-scale viability of the hydrogen economy. The program will also result in reduced usage of sparse precious metals in electrolyzer construction.
